SEO HTML: How HTML Tags Power Search Visibility

Written by
SEO HTML
Table of Contents

Search engines rely on structure to understand a web page, and HTML provides that structure. When SEO and HTML work together, your content becomes easier to interpret, index, and rank. Every HTML document contains signals that tell search engines what a page is about, how it relates to other pages, and how it should appear in a search result. From the title tag and meta description to structured data and canonical tags, the way you use HTML code directly affects your website’s SEO value.

This guide explains how SEO HTML works, which HTML tags you need, and how to use them as part of a strong on-page SEO strategy. If you want users and search engines to understand your content, the right tags, placed properly, are essential.

1. Understanding the Relationship Between HTML and SEO

HTML is the language that defines the structure of every web page. Search engines read HTML code to extract meaning, relevance, and hierarchy. When tags tell search engines what each section represents, your page becomes easier to crawl and interpret.

From an SEO perspective, HTML tags are not just technical elements. They communicate content structure, keywords, and intent to search engines. Google may use information found in tags when displaying your page in Google Search, which means your SEO efforts start at the tag level. HTML tags for SEO are therefore part of basic SEO, not an advanced afterthought.

Well-structured HTML also supports user experience. Clear headings, descriptive links, and optimized meta tags help users and search engines alike, which is why HTML tags are important for both usability and SEO ranking.

2. Title Tags and Meta Description: Your First Search Impression

The role of the title tag

The title tag is one of the most important HTML tags for SEO. This tag helps search engines understand the topic of your web page and often appears as the main clickable headline in a search result. A well-written title tag with a relevant keyword improves SEO value and increases the likelihood that users click on your page.

From a best practice standpoint, you should optimize your title tags to be clear, concise, and relevant to the search queries you want to target. Google Search Console can help you evaluate how your title and meta perform in real search results.

The importance of the meta description tag

The meta description is a short summary of your page that may appear below the title in search results. While it is not a direct ranking factor, an enticing meta description improves click-through rate, which supports your overall SEO efforts.

The meta description tag should accurately describe the content of your web page and include your primary keyword naturally. A strong meta description is both informative for users and helpful for search engines that want to understand the page context.

3. Heading Tags and Content Structure

How heading tags organize your HTML document

Heading tags such as H1, H2, and H3 define the hierarchy of your content. These header tags structure your page, making it easier for users and search engines to scan and understand. From an SEO perspective, heading tags tell search engines which topics are most important on the page.

Your H1 should represent the main topic of the page and include your primary keyword when relevant. Subheadings break content into logical sections and reinforce related concepts. Proper use of heading tags improves content structure, page structure, and the overall SEO value of your web page.

Semantic HTML and SEO

Semantic HTML tags, such as <article>, <section>, and <nav>, help search engines understand the role of different parts of your HTML document. These tags are part of modern SEO HTML because they provide context beyond visual layout. When search engines understand your content structure, they can better match it to relevant search queries.

4. Meta Tags, Robots Directives, and Canonical URLs

Meta tags that guide search engines

Meta tags include instructions and information for search engines. The robots meta tags, for example, tell search engines whether to index a page or follow its links. These tags can prevent duplicate content issues and control which pages appear in Google Search.

The canonical tag is another essential element. It tells search engines which version of a URL is the preferred one when multiple URLs display the same or similar content. Without a canonical tag, search engines may split ranking signals across different URLs, reducing your SEO performance.

Why canonical tags matter

Canonical tags help search engines understand which URL should be considered the main version of a page. This is crucial for websites with parameters, filters, or similar content across multiple URLs. From an SEO perspective, canonical tags consolidate ranking signals and protect your website’s SEO from dilution.

5. Image Tags, Alt Attributes, and Accessibility

Images contribute to user experience, but search engines cannot interpret them without HTML attributes. The alt attribute provides text that describes an image. This text helps search engines understand what the image represents and improves accessibility for users who rely on screen readers.

Using descriptive alt attributes is one of the important HTML tags for SEO. It allows images to appear in image search results and adds context to your page. When used correctly, alt attributes contribute to both on-page SEO and user experience.

6. Structured Data, Open Graph, and Rich Results

How structured data enhances SEO HTML

Structured data is a form of HTML markup that helps search engines understand your content at a deeper level. By using structured data, you can qualify for rich result features such as star ratings, FAQs, or product information in search results.

Tags like JSON-LD scripts are embedded within your HTML document and tell search engines exactly what your data represents. This helps search engines understand your content beyond basic keywords and supports advanced SEO strategies.

Open Graph tags and social visibility

Open Graph tags control how your web page appears when shared on social platforms. While these tags are not direct ranking factors, they improve click-through and engagement, which supports SEO indirectly. Open Graph tags, along with other meta tags, are part of a comprehensive HTML SEO approach.

7. Best Practices for Using HTML Tags in SEO

Using HTML tags correctly requires both technical precision and strategic thinking. Tags and meta elements should always reflect the content of the page and support your SEO goals.

Focus on writing accurate, keyword-aware title and meta description tags. Use heading tags to create a logical content structure. Implement canonical tags where needed, and use structured data to enhance visibility in search results. Avoid over-optimization, as keyword stuffing in tags can harm your SEO value.

For ongoing improvement, tools like Yoast SEO, SEO extensions, and Google Search Console can assist with audits and identify issues in your HTML tags and attributes. From a local SEO or on-page SEO perspective, clean HTML is foundational to every SEO task.

FAQs About SEO HTML

What is SEO HTML?

SEO HTML refers to the practice of using HTML tags and attributes in a way that helps search engines understand your content, structure your pages correctly, and improve visibility in search results.

Which HTML tags are most important for SEO?

The title tag, meta description tag, heading tags, canonical tag, and alt attribute are among the most important HTML tags for SEO because they tell search engines what your page is about and how it should appear in search results.

Does structured data improve rankings?

Structured data does not directly increase rankings, but it can lead to rich results that improve click-through rates and visibility. This supports your SEO efforts and overall SEO value.

Can incorrect HTML tags hurt SEO?

Yes. Missing, duplicated, or poorly written tags can confuse search engines, reduce relevance signals, and negatively impact SEO ranking. Proper use of tags is crucial for SEO.

How do I check my HTML tags for SEO?

You can use SEO audit tools, browser developer tools, SEO extensions, and platforms like Google Search Console to analyze your HTML code and identify issues with tags and meta elements.

Conclusion of SEO HTML

SEO HTML is the technical backbone of effective on-page optimization. By using HTML tags properly, you help search engines understand your content, improve how your pages appear in search results, and strengthen your website’s overall SEO value. From title tags and meta descriptions to structured data and canonical URLs, each element plays a role in how your site is interpreted by search engines.

A well-structured HTML document benefits both users and search engines. When your tags are accurate, your content is accessible, and your markup follows best practices, your SEO efforts become more efficient and sustainable. Mastering SEO HTML is not about complexity; it is about clarity, structure, and communicating your content in a language search engines understand.